Battousai wondered what Katsura-sama would think of his most prized assassin, if said assassin were to tell Katsura-sama that he constantly conversed with a ghost.

A very pretty, very young, very talkative ghost.

"I'm really more of a spirit," Kaoru was cheerfully insisting and drilling a hole into Kenshin's ear with her nonsensical chatter. "And I really would prefer if you didn't off someone on sacred grounds," she continued, pointing emphatically at the shrine steps in front of their hiding place.

"Sanctuary means nothing if their name falls into my hands," he ground out, "now be quiet."

"You know, you'll be in a better mood if you ambush him on a street instead of on the steps of a temple," she sniffed. "Oh, wait, you're always insufferable. Whatever I did was not worth having to be stuck to you."

He ignored her, spying lantern light ascending the steps towards them. Silently, he thumbed the hilt of his sword, and like always, she fell silent as soon as his blade inched out of its sheath.

She didn't say anything until the sword was back in the scabbard and the steps were red.

"Well," she rubbed at her eyes as she hovered over the mess, "at least they don't have to go far to ask for directions."
